Condition of the Vinyl

When purchasing a vinyl record, the condition is paramount. I always check for any visible scratches, warps, or signs of wear. A well-maintained LP can significantly enhance the listening experience. I look for records that are graded as “Near Mint” or “Very Good Plus” to ensure quality sound.

Record Label and Pressing Information

The label and pressing can greatly influence the sound quality of the LP. I pay attention to details like the label’s name and the pressing year. Original pressings can sometimes offer a different sound experience compared to later reissues, so I make sure to do my homework on this aspect.
